One of the most significant benefits of smart home technology is its ability to enhance daily life through automation. Devices like smart thermostats learn your schedule and adjust temperatures accordingly, ensuring optimal comfort without manual intervention. Smart lighting systems can be programmed to turn on and off at specific times or respond to voice commands, eliminating the need to fumble for switches in the dark. These innovations not only save time but also contribute to energy efficiency, reducing utility bills and environmental impact.
Security is another area where smart home products shine. Smart cameras and doorbell systems allow homeowners to monitor their property remotely, receiving real-time alerts on their smartphones if any unusual activity is detected. Smart locks provide keyless entry, and some even allow temporary access codes for guests or service personnel. These features offer peace of mind, knowing that your home is protected even when you’re not there.

Health and wellness are increasingly integrated into smart home ecosystems. Air purifiers with smart capabilities can monitor air quality and adjust settings to maintain a healthy environment. Smart refrigerators track food inventory and suggest recipes based on available ingredients, promoting healthier eating habits. Wearable devices sync with home systems to monitor sleep patterns and adjust lighting and temperature to improve rest quality.
The convenience offered by smart home products extends to everyday tasks. Smart appliances like robotic vacuum cleaners and lawn mowers operate autonomously, saving time and effort. Smart kitchen gadgets can assist with meal preparation, from automatically adjusting cooking times to providing step-by-step recipes. These devices streamline daily chores, allowing individuals to focus on more important aspects of their lives.
Despite the numerous advantages, it’s essential to consider the potential challenges of integrating smart home technology. Compatibility issues between devices from different manufacturers can complicate setup and operation. Privacy concerns also arise, as these devices collect data on daily activities. It’s crucial to research and choose products from reputable brands that prioritize user privacy and offer robust security features.
